Quarterly Planning Note — Warranty Cost Overrun

Warranty expenses for the Orvane compressor line exceeded plan by 31% this quarter, driven by a seal defect in units shipped from the Dunmere plant. Finance should update reserve assumptions and reforecast accordingly. A supplier remediation program begins next month. Implications for next year's product strategy are set out in the confidential note below.

internal memo for kawip-hadug: Headcount on the Wenwyn team goes from 7 to 140 by the end of January. Gross margin on Wenwyn came in at 20 percent against a plan of 15 percent.

Key ceremony checklist — step 4 (FanGate)

Rotate the FanGate signing key used by the notification fan-out backpressure controller. On-call: expect a brief pause in fan-out while the controller re-reads its config; queues will buffer, backpressure limits stay enforced. Verify queue depth returns under threshold within five minutes. To commit the rotated key to the controller's keystore, enter the recovery passphrase below.

unlock words, yawig-kagef: gordor-holvan-ulaael-pramir-ulaiel-tamdor

The credentials used by the Mapling address autocomplete widget to call the internal Gridpost geocoding service expired on the 14th, causing silent fallbacks to cached results. Impact was limited to the checkout flow on Tollbrook storefronts. A replacement credential has been issued with the same read-only scope and a 90-day lifetime. For verification during review, the new key appears below.

gateway credential: kto3_qfe

Subject: Q3 Cash-Flow Forecast — Quick Read

Hi all — sharing the quarterly cash-flow picture for Merrowvale Instruments before Thursday's exec call. Short version: collections improved nicely, so operating cash lands about 7% above plan. The Tilbrook expansion pulls some of that back out in month two, and we're carrying a heavier inventory build for the Solvane launch. Sales leads, keep an eye on payment terms on new deals — no stretching past sixty days, please. Full model attached. The confidential business-plan note sits just below.

management briefing: Project Ulavan slips by two quarters because of the staffing delay.